18 July 2019 – Coach David Notoane has named his 23-man squad to play Lesotho in the CAF Orange CHAN qualifiers for the Ethiopia 2020 championships.

South Africa play Lesotho in the first leg on 28 July at Setsoto Stadium with the return leg scheduled for 4 August in Johannesburg.

Notoane has retained most of the players who took part in the recently ended Senior Men’s COSAFA Cup tournament that took place in Durban from 26 May to 8 June 2019 where South Africa won the Plate after beating Malawi 5-4 on penalties.

As per CHAN’s requirements, the tournament is only for local based players.
